Maybe: If your period is coming and was 7 days late it is likely to be heavier and more painful than usual. So see if your period comes in the next day or so. If the pain gets really bad you need to be seen.

Pregnancy test : Home pregnancy tests are very accurate. They are the same tests used in a doctors office. This is the first step. If the pain continues you will need to be evaluated by your doctor to investigate the many causes of pelvic cramping. This could be anything from an ovarian cyst, infection or intestinal problem.
